Output 3b91aa2d2ed3d7a1795806afcd7517d0628d4c4f41bd81142e2c4eedb9706ac1:1

value
2606
script pubkey
OP_0 OP_PUSHBYTES_20 a087a1d604f99ef64a65050fa4dd2b0789c45f38
address
tb1q5zr6r4sylx00vjn9q586fhftq7yughecaqsqm2
transaction
3b91aa2d2ed3d7a1795806afcd7517d0628d4c4f41bd81142e2c4eedb9706ac1
confirmations
69152
spent
true